Polymtrade
Polymtrade is a dedicated mobile trading terminal designed exclusively for Polymarket, the prediction market protocol where users take positions on real-world outcomes ranging from elections and sports to macroeconomic events. Launched in early 2025 by a three-person team based in Central Europe with over a decade of combined crypto experience, Polymtrade addresses a structural gap in the Polymarket ecosystem: the absence of a native mobile application. The terminal is available on both iOS via the App Store and Android via Google Play. Polymarket itself has long lacked a dedicated mobile application, leaving traders to navigate a browser-based interface on handheld devices. Polymtrade was built to fill that gap with a mobile-first architecture that the team claims delivers four times faster performance than accessing Polymarket through a mobile browser. The platform pulls live market data and real-time quotes into a purpose-built interface, removing the friction of reformatted desktop pages on a phone screen. One of Polymtrade's primary differentiators is an integrated AI prediction bot trained on more than 55,000 resolved Polymarket markets. Rather than offering generic market commentary, the model uses historical outcomes across the full range of Polymarket categories to generate probability estimates and trading suggestions on active markets. The platform publishes a public dashboard displaying the bot's trade history and analytics, allowing users to evaluate its track record before relying on its signals. The team has planned a second version of the prediction engine that will draw on five separate AI models in parallel, though this feature had not launched as of mid-2026. The AI tools are accessible to holders of the platform's $PM token; non-holders can still trade but do not receive AI insights. Polymtrade operates on a self-custodial model. Users connect their own wallets and personally sign every transaction. The platform never takes custody of funds and never holds or touches user money. The terminal supports trading across multiple blockchains: Polygon is the recommended network and the one through which Polymarket itself operates. Additional supported networks include Solana, Ethereum, Binance Smart Chain, Base, Arbitrum, Optimism, and World Chain. Wallet compatibility is broad, covering Phantom, MetaMask, OKX, Revolut, and other EVM-compatible wallets. Users who prefer not to import an external wallet can generate one directly inside the app through a Privy integration available for both Polygon and Solana accounts. Private key export and import are supported, meaning wallets created inside Polymtrade can be moved to any external application. For traders on Polygon, Polymtrade covers the gas fees associated with transaction execution, eliminating the need to hold POL separately. Deposits are accepted in USDC, with the platform automatically converting incoming USDT, DAI, WETH, WBTC, and USDC.e to USDC on receipt. Funding options include direct crypto transfers from external wallets, debit and credit card payments via MoonPay, and Apple Pay. Withdrawals return USDC to user-controlled wallets on any of the supported networks. The transaction flow is simplified compared to interacting directly with Polymarket's contracts: Polymtrade merges multiple on-chain steps into single user actions, reducing the number of wallet signature prompts required to complete a trade. Polymtrade has issued a utility token, $PM, deployed on the Solana blockchain at contract address 3BWA5RBXyPXuMGZmVL8Snefu573FMJNGpsVi79baiBLV. The team states it does not control the contract. Total supply is approximately 999.97 million $PM. Traders who do not hold $PM pay a 0.5% fee on buy and sell transactions. Traders who hold one million or more $PM tokens pay zero fees across all markets. This threshold-based model is designed to incentivize accumulation of the token rather than requiring payment per trade. Fee revenue generated from non-holders is routed into automatic $PM buybacks rather than held by the team. Purchased tokens are then locked for use in bounties, campaigns, and partnership programs. As of mid-2026, 71 million $PM had been burned. The platform has stated a growth target of capturing 1% of Polymarket's total trading volume, which at historical Polymarket daily volumes would generate approximately $3,000 per day in fee revenue to fund buybacks and a referral rewards program. Additional benefits for $PM holders include access to the AI prediction tools, early access to beta features, and inclusion in a referral rewards program that was in development as of mid-2026. Completed milestones as of mid-2026 include the iOS and Android app releases, MoonPay integration, the AI prediction bot and its public dashboard, an advanced market search function, a redesigned trading interface, and the referral system groundwork. Upcoming features on the public roadmap include integration with Kalshi, the regulated U.S. prediction market, which would allow Polymtrade to serve as a single interface across both major prediction market venues. Cross-platform arbitrage tools, copy trading, an in-app $PM token purchase flow, and a subscription model with token burning are also listed as planned. While Polymarket's prediction markets operate primarily on Polygon, Polymtrade's utility token lives on Solana. This deployment positions the project within the Solana ecosystem for token trading and accumulation purposes, while the underlying prediction market activity itself flows through Polygon's settlement layer. Traders interacting with $PM for fee benefits, speculation, or referral rewards do so via Solana wallets and decentralized exchanges on Solana, including Phantom, where the token is listed.
